Output e63de004e936768e0e723f36c0a3a53983b1b932bc0336e314d0eafcc507046d:0

value
130800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 003e146ad1274b44f3ee73c022d9254336de437b OP_EQUAL
address
31iJHvMdcJrZPcyZY8b75VwHtfQN2oQuU4
transaction
e63de004e936768e0e723f36c0a3a53983b1b932bc0336e314d0eafcc507046d
confirmations
258947
spent
true